Andrew Plimer

Andrew Plimer was a British miniature painter and portraitist.

His older brother was Nathaniel Plimer, also a miniature painter. They were first trained by their watchmaker father, and later studied the art of miniature painting together in London with the famous portrait painter Richard Cosway (1742-1821). Andrew Plimer specialized in portrait miniature painting and excelled in it, his work being exhibited at the Royal Academy.
